Haircare routines

Easy, natural haircare habits you can adopt daily

The primary requirement for healthy hair is keeping the scalp clean. Excessive sweat, dust, and grime accumulation can weaken hair. But this also doesn’t mean shampooing too much daily. It is considered better to clean hair based on necessity and the season.

Many people still think oiling is an old-fashioned habit, but experts say a light massage can help a lot of people. Coconut oil, almond oil, or a light hair oil can keep the scalp from getting dry. But leaving too much oil on for a long time isn’t right for everyone.

A common mistake is rubbing your hair hard after washing. Wet hair is weaker, so drying it gently is preferable. Using very hot water can also cause more dryness. Additionally, frequent use of heat appliances such as straighteners, curlers, and excessive blow-drying can harm your hair. Some people style daily, but this can affect hair strength over time.

Domestic solutions like yogurt, aloe vera, fenugreek, or amla have been integral to hair maintenance for a long time. Nevertheless, not every solution yields the same results for everyone, making it advisable to tailor usage to individual requirements.

Haircare routines

Diet affects things, not just oil and shampoo.

Many people forget that the true strength of hair does not come from outside alone. If the body does not get proper nutrition, its effect can be seen on the hair also.

Doctors and experts say that food rich in protein, iron and vitamins is considered essential for hair. Pulses, green vegetables, fruits, dry fruits and adequate water can be beneficial for the health of the body as well as hair.

Stress is also considered a major cause of hair fall. Many people live under pressure due to work, studies or personal life, the effect of which gradually starts showing on the body and hair. Therefore, adequate sleep and some rest are also considered necessary.

If hair is falling excessively, suddenly thinning, or there is constant itching and discomfort in the scalp, then it should not be ignored. Sometimes it can also be a sign of some internal problem.
